GNU bug report logs - #61395
28.2; bug-reference warning seems incorrect

Previous Next

Package: emacs;

Reported by: Tom Tromey <tom <at> tromey.com>

Date: Thu, 9 Feb 2023 19:10:02 UTC

Severity: normal

Found in version 28.2

Done: Tassilo Horn <tsdh <at> gnu.org>

Bug is archived. No further changes may be made.

Full log


Message #40 received at 61395 <at> debbugs.gnu.org (full text, mbox):

From: Kévin Le Gouguec <kevin.legouguec <at> gmail.com>
To: 61395 <at> debbugs.gnu.org
Cc: tom <at> tromey.com, tsdh <at> gnu.org
Subject: Re: bug#61395: 28.2; bug-reference warning seems incorrect
Date: Sat, 11 Feb 2023 10:33:29 +0100
Tassilo Horn <tsdh <at> gnu.org> writes:

> Thanks a lot and 100 bonus points to Kévin who has been right with his
> analysis.

s/analysis/'irrational fear of anything match-data related'/

…

s/irrational/'not always entirely unwarranted'/


Just living by Dr Monnier's wise words from bug#35564:

>>                I just tend to get superstitious about messing with match
>> data.
> 
> Instead, you should get superstitious about using the match data too
> far from the corresponding match.

Amen 🙏


(I've since learned that "too far" really means "one function call away,
if that function is declared neither 'pure nor 'side-effect-free")




This bug report was last modified 2 years and 101 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.